【Nihon Fukushi University】About approach of local cooperation

Since 2014, the University has been fostering “FUKUSHI Meister” as a project adopted by the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ology.

Issues such as declining birthrate and aging and regional revitalization of 5 cities and 5 towns of the Chita Peninsula (Tokai City, Obu City, Chita City, Tokoname City, Handa City, Higashiura Town, Agui Town, Taketoyo Town, Mihama Town, Minami Chita Town) Based on this, we promote education through regional collaboration. We will cultivate “FUKUSHI Meister,” a human resource that supports the social society with citizen power, discovery power, initiative and resolution. First certified FUKUSHI Meister for graduates at the end of 2018. We were able to certify 648, the majority of graduates.

 

In addition, we are promoting the “regional collaboration platform” that promotes exchanges between local people and students / faculty staff, brings together local issues, and solves them. In order to revitalize the research, we created a registration system called “Region (Knowledge) Meister / Region(Knowledge) Field”. As of July 2019, 49 Meisters and 41 fields are registered.
